Hello Francesco, thank you for your answer
this is my code:
class changemanual_change(osv.osv):
def get_convertedamount(self, cr,uid,ids,field_name,arg,context=None):
res={}
if context is None:
context = {}
pchange = self.pool.get('changemanual.change').browse(cr,uid,id,)
res['convertedamount']=pchange['conversionrate']*pchange['amountbeconverted']
return res
_name = 'changemanual.change'
_columns = {
'partner_id': fields.many2one('res.partner','Customer'),
'currency_id'
In this line pchange = self.pool.get('changemanual.change').browse(cr,uid,id,) you call "id" but id is not defined.
Browse objects employ object notation to access attributes. Try
pchange.conversionrate*pchange.amountbeconverted
Also I advise conditional test for existence of value.
if pchange.conversionrate and pchange.amountbeconverted:
res['convertedamount'] = pchange.conversionrate*pchange.amountbeconverted
Otherwise you have typeerror when ORM returns False.
